วิธีการแปลง HTML เป็น XLSX โดยใช้ GroupDocs.Conversion .NET: คู่มือฉบับสมบูรณ์

การแนะนำ

คุณกำลังมองหาวิธีแปลงไฟล์ HTML เป็นรูปแบบ Excel ได้อย่างราบรื่นหรือไม่ บทช่วยสอนที่ครอบคลุมนี้จะแสดงวิธีใช้ GroupDocs.การแปลงสำหรับ .NET เพื่อแปลงเอกสาร HTML ของคุณให้เป็นรูปแบบ XLSX ที่ใช้กันอย่างแพร่หลายได้อย่างง่ายดาย โดยทำตามคำแนะนำนี้ คุณจะผสานความสามารถในการแปลงไฟล์เข้ากับแอปพลิเคชัน .NET ของคุณโดยตรง

สิ่งที่คุณจะได้เรียนรู้:

  • วิธีตั้งค่าและกำหนดค่า GroupDocs.Conversion สำหรับ .NET
  • การดำเนินการทีละขั้นตอนในการแปลงไฟล์ HTML เป็น XLSX
  • แนวทางปฏิบัติที่ดีที่สุดสำหรับการเพิ่มประสิทธิภาพระหว่างการแปลง

มาเริ่มต้นด้วยการทำความเข้าใจข้อกำหนดเบื้องต้นที่คุณจะต้องมีก่อนจะเริ่มใช้งาน

ข้อกำหนดเบื้องต้น

ก่อนที่จะนำโซลูชันนี้ไปใช้ โปรดตรวจสอบว่าสภาพแวดล้อมการพัฒนาของคุณได้รับการเตรียมพร้อมด้วยส่วนประกอบที่จำเป็นแล้ว:

ไลบรารีและเวอร์ชันที่จำเป็น:

  • GroupDocs.การแปลงสำหรับ .NET: เวอร์ชัน 25.3.0
  • กรอบงาน .NET: ตรวจสอบให้แน่ใจว่าเข้ากันได้กับข้อกำหนดเวอร์ชันของ GroupDocs

การตั้งค่าสภาพแวดล้อม:

  • 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้ง Visual Studio เพื่อจัดการโครงการของคุณ
  • ระบบของคุณควรรองรับการติดตั้งแพ็คเกจ NuGet

ข้อกำหนดเบื้องต้นของความรู้:

  • ความเข้าใจพื้นฐานในการเขียนโปรแกรม C#
  • ความคุ้นเคยกับการดำเนินการ I/O ของไฟล์ใน .NET

การตั้งค่า GroupDocs.Conversion สำหรับ .NET

หากต้องการเริ่มใช้ GroupDocs.Conversion คุณต้องติดตั้งก่อน โดยทำตามขั้นตอนดังนี้:

คอนโซลตัวจัดการแพ็กเกจ N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

การได้มาซึ่งใบอนุญาต:

  • ทดลองใช้งานฟรี:รับทดลองใช้งานฟรีเพื่อทดสอบคุณสมบัติทั้งหมดของ GroupDocs.Conversion
  • ใบอนุญาตชั่วคราว:หากต้องการระยะเวลาเพิ่มเติมนอกเหนือจากช่วงทดลองใช้งาน ให้ยื่นขอใบอนุญาตชั่วคราว
  • ซื้อ:ควรพิจารณาซื้อใบอนุญาตเพื่อใช้งานในระยะยาว

เมื่อติดตั้งแล้ว ให้เริ่มต้นและตั้งค่า GroupDocs.Conversion ด้วยการตั้งค่า C# ขั้นพื้นฐานนี้:

using GroupDocs.Conversion;
// เริ่มต้นการกำหนดค่าการแปลงหรือการตั้งค่าที่นี่ (ถ้าจำเป็น)

คู่มือการใช้งาน

แปลง HTML เป็น XLSX

ภาพรวม:ส่วนนี้มุ่งเน้นที่การแปลงไฟล์ HTML เป็นรูปแบบ XLSX โดยใช้ GroupDocs.Conversion

ขั้นตอนที่ 1: กำหนดไดเรกทอรีและโหลดไฟล์ต้นฉบับ

เริ่มต้นด้วยการกำหนดไดเรกทอรีอินพุตและเอาต์พุตของคุณ ตรวจสอบว่าคุณมีไฟล์ HTML ตัวอย่างชื่อ sample.html ในไดเร็กทอรีอินพุตของคุณ

string YOUR_DOCUMENT_DIRECTORY = @"YOUR_DOCUMENT_DIRECTORY";
string YOUR_OUTPUT_DIRECTORY = @"YOUR_OUTPUT_DIRECTORY";\n
using (var converter = new Converter(YOUR_DOCUMENT_DIRECTORY + "/sample.html"))
{
    // ดำเนินการตั้งค่าและดำเนินการแปลง
}

ขั้นตอนที่ 2: ตั้งค่าตัวเลือกการแปลง

ใช้ SpreadsheetConvertOptions เพื่อระบุว่าคุณต้องการเอาต์พุตเป็นรูปแบบ XLSX

var options = new SpreadsheetConvertOptions();
string outputFile = Path.Combine(YOUR_OUTPUT_DIRECTORY, "html-converted-to.xlsx");

การ options วัตถุช่วยให้สามารถกำหนดค่าการตั้งค่าการแปลง เช่น ช่วงหน้า หรือการกำหนดค่าเฉพาะเอกสาร

ขั้นตอนที่ 3: ดำเนินการแปลงและบันทึก

ดำเนินการตามกระบวนการแปลงและบันทึกไฟล์ที่แปลงแล้วของคุณ

converter.Convert(outputFile, options);

บรรทัดนี้จะทริกเกอร์การแปลงจริงจาก HTML เป็น XLSX โดยใช้ตัวเลือกที่ระบุ

เคล็ดลับการแก้ไขปัญหา:

  • ให้แน่ใจว่า YOUR_DOCUMENT_DIRECTORY ประกอบด้วยเส้นทางที่ถูกต้องไปยังไฟล์ HTML ที่มีอยู่
  • ตรวจสอบสิทธิ์การเขียนสำหรับ YOUR_OUTPUT_DIRECTORY-

การประยุกต์ใช้งานจริง

  1. การรายงานข้อมูล:แปลงรายงานข้อมูลบนเว็บเป็นรูปแบบ Excel เพื่อการจัดการและวิเคราะห์ที่ง่ายดายยิ่งขึ้น
  2. การจัดการเอกสารทางการเงิน:แปลงบันทึกธุรกรรมจากแดชบอร์ด HTML เป็นไฟล์ XLSX เพื่อวัตถุประสงค์ทางการบัญชี
  3. การบูรณาการกับระบบ CRM:ใช้ความสามารถในการแปลงเพื่อนำเข้าข้อมูลการขายจากพอร์ทัลออนไลน์โดยตรงไปยัง CRM ของคุณในรูปแบบที่เป็นมิตรกับ Excel

การพิจารณาประสิทธิภาพ

เพื่อประสิทธิภาพที่เหมาะสมที่สุด โปรดพิจารณา:

  • ลดการใช้หน่วยความจำโดยประมวลผลไฟล์ตามลำดับแทนที่จะประมวลผลพร้อมๆ กันเมื่อทำได้
  • ใช้วิธีการแบบอะซิงโครนัส หากรองรับ เพื่อปรับปรุงการตอบสนองระหว่างการแปลง

แนวทางปฏิบัติที่ดีที่สุดได้แก่ การจัดการทรัพยากรอย่างมีประสิทธิภาพและการตรวจสอบประสิทธิภาพการทำงานของแอพพลิเคชันระหว่างการดำเนินการกับไฟล์

บทสรุป

ตอนนี้คุณได้เรียนรู้วิธีการตั้งค่าและใช้ GroupDocs.Conversion สำหรับ .NET เพื่อแปลงเอกสาร HTML เป็นไฟล์ XLSX แล้ว เครื่องมืออันทรงพลังนี้สามารถปรับปรุงเวิร์กโฟลว์การประมวลผลข้อมูลของคุณได้โดยบูรณาการกับแอปพลิเคชัน .NET ต่างๆ ได้อย่างราบรื่น

ขั้นตอนต่อไป

  • ทดลองใช้ตัวเลือกการแปลงต่างๆ ที่มีใน SpreadsheetConvertOptions-
  • สำรวจรูปแบบไฟล์อื่น ๆ ที่ได้รับการรองรับโดย GroupDocs.Conversion

พร้อมที่จะนำโซลูชันนี้ไปใช้หรือยัง เจาะลึกความสามารถของโซลูชันนี้และเริ่มแปลงไฟล์ของคุณวันนี้!

ส่วนคำถามที่พบบ่อย

ถาม: เวอร์ชันใดของ .NET ที่เข้ากันได้กับ GroupDocs.Conversion สำหรับ .NET? ตอบ: GroupDocs.Conversion รองรับหลายเวอร์ชัน โปรดดูข้อมูลจำเพาะในเอกสารอย่างเป็นทางการ

ถาม: ฉันจะจัดการไฟล์ HTML ขนาดใหญ่ในระหว่างการแปลงได้อย่างไร ตอบ ควรพิจารณาแบ่งไฟล์ขนาดใหญ่เป็นส่วนย่อยๆ หากเป็นไปได้ เพื่อจัดการการใช้หน่วยความจำได้อย่างมีประสิทธิภาพ

ถาม: ฉันสามารถปรับแต่งรูปแบบเอาต์พุตในไฟล์ XLSX ได้หรือไม่ ตอบ: ใช่ GroupDocs.Conversion มีตัวเลือกการปรับแต่งมากมายผ่านการตั้งค่า API

ถาม: ฉันควรทำอย่างไร หากการแปลงล้มเหลวโดยไม่คาดคิด? ก. ตรวจสอบข้อผิดพลาดเกี่ยวกับเส้นทางไฟล์และตรวจสอบว่าสภาพแวดล้อมของคุณมีทรัพยากรเพียงพอ ดูบันทึกเพื่อดูข้อความแสดงข้อผิดพลาด

ถาม: มีข้อจำกัดใด ๆ ในการแปลงไฟล์ HTML ด้วยเครื่องมือนี้หรือไม่? A: แม้ว่าจะมีความสามารถสูง แต่องค์ประกอบเว็บที่ซับซ้อนบางอย่างอาจไม่สามารถแปลงได้อย่างสมบูรณ์แบบ เนื่องมาจากความแตกต่างระหว่างการเรนเดอร์เว็บและรูปแบบ Excel

ทรัพยากร

หากทำตามคู่มือนี้ คุณจะสามารถผสานการแปลง HTML เป็น XLSX ลงในแอปพลิเคชัน .NET ได้อย่างง่ายดาย ขอให้สนุกกับการเขียนโค้ด!